High Variability Between Replicates (CV >15%)

Symptom
Replicate wells for the same sample or standard show high coefficient of variation (>15%), with inconsistent absorbance values that suggest uneven treatment or technical errors.
Common Causes
  1. 1 Solutions insufficiently mixed before addition, or uneven plate coating due to pipetting error
  2. 2 Evaporation during coating step (no plate sealer used) or coating antibody concentration too low to saturate wells
  3. 3 Inadequate washing leaving residual solution in wells; automatic washer ports obstructed
  4. 4 Bubbles in wells affecting optical reading
  5. 5 Contaminated buffers, pipette tips, or carry-over between samples
Solutions
  1. 1 Thoroughly mix each solution before adding to plate; verify equal volume addition per well
  2. 2 Use plate sealer during coating; extend coating time to overnight at 4°C for low antibody concentrations
  3. 3 Ensure complete solution removal between washes; check washer ports; add 30-second soak and rotate plate mid-wash
  4. 4 Centrifuge plate before reading to remove bubbles
  5. 5 Prepare fresh buffers; use fresh tips for each sample; avoid tip reuse
